Core Components of a PhD in Cyber Security Programs

Doctoral programs in cybersecurity share common structural elements, though specific requirements vary by institution. Understanding these components helps you evaluate which program aligns with your goals and lifestyle.

Advanced Coursework and Foundational Knowledge

The first two to three years typically involve intensive coursework designed to build deep expertise. Classes often cover advanced cryptography, network security, secure software development, digital forensics, and risk management. You will also study research methods, statistics, and the philosophy of science to prepare for your own investigations. Many programs require a sequence in information security theory that traces the evolution of the discipline from its roots in computer science to its current interdisciplinary scope, incorporating elements of law, psychology, and business. This phase ensures you have a comprehensive foundation before moving into specialized research.

Comprehensive Examinations

After completing coursework, you must pass comprehensive exams that test your mastery of the field. These exams are often written and oral, requiring you to synthesize knowledge across multiple domains. They can be daunting, but they serve an essential purpose: they demonstrate that you are ready to contribute original scholarship. Preparation typically involves months of intensive review, and some programs allow you to focus on your chosen specialization area, such as cryptography or organizational cybersecurity policy.

The Dissertation: Original Research

The heart of any cybersecurity doctorate is the dissertation. This is a substantial piece of original research that makes a novel contribution to the field. You will work closely with a faculty advisor and committee to identify a research question, design a methodology, collect and analyze data, and defend your findings. Topics can range from developing new cryptographic protocols to studying the effectiveness of security awareness training. The process teaches you to think independently, manage a long-term project, and communicate complex ideas clearly. For many students, the dissertation is both the most challenging and the most rewarding part of the journey.

Research Opportunities in Cybersecurity Doctorates

One of the most exciting aspects of pursuing a information security phd is the chance to engage with cutting-edge research. Doctoral programs are not just about consuming existing knowledge. They are about creating it. Students have opportunities to collaborate with faculty on funded research projects, present at conferences, and publish in peer-reviewed journals. This work often addresses real-world problems, giving you a platform to make a tangible difference.

Key research areas currently attracting attention and funding include:

  • Artificial intelligence and machine learning for threat detection and response
  • Quantum-resistant cryptography and post-quantum security protocols
  • Human factors in cybersecurity, including user behavior and insider threats
  • Critical infrastructure protection for energy, water, and transportation systems
  • Cybersecurity policy, law, and international governance frameworks

These areas are not just academic exercises. They directly inform the strategies that organizations use to protect themselves. For example, research on machine learning for intrusion detection has led to systems that can identify novel attacks in real time. Studies on human factors have improved security training programs, reducing the likelihood of phishing success. By choosing a research focus that aligns with your interests and career goals, you can position yourself as an expert in a high-demand niche.

Furthermore, many universities have partnerships with government agencies like the National Security Agency (NSA) and the Department of Homeland Security (DHS), as well as private sector companies. These partnerships provide access to real-world data, funding for research assistantships, and potential employment pathways after graduation. When evaluating PhD in Cyber Security Programs and Research Opportunities, consider not only the curriculum but also the research centers and labs affiliated with the program. Strong programs often have designated centers for cybersecurity research that bring together faculty, students, and industry partners.

When evaluating programs, verify accreditation. Regional accreditation is essential for academic credibility. Additionally, look for designations like the National Centers of Academic Excellence in Cyber Defense (CAE-CD) from the NSA and DHS. This designation signals that the program meets rigorous standards for cybersecurity education. Also consider faculty expertise, research output, and the availability of funding through assistantships or fellowships.

Financial Considerations and Funding

Pursuing a PhD in cyber security is an investment, but it need not be financially crippling. Many doctoral programs offer funding packages that include tuition waivers and stipends in exchange for teaching or research assistantships. These packages are more common in on-campus programs but are increasingly available for online students as well. Federal financial aid, employer tuition reimbursement, and scholarships from organizations like the (ISC)2 and SANS Institute can also offset costs.

It is wise to research the return on investment for specific programs. Graduates from top programs often secure positions with starting salaries well above six figures, particularly in industry. Academic positions may pay less initially but offer other benefits like intellectual freedom and job stability. Career Paths After a Cybersecurity Doctorate

The career options for those holding a PhD in cyber security are diverse and rewarding. Academia remains a popular choice, with doctoral graduates becoming professors, researchers, and department chairs at universities worldwide. These roles involve teaching, mentoring students, and conducting funded research. The demand for cybersecurity faculty far outstrips supply, making it a favorable job market for new PhDs.

Industry roles are equally compelling. Large technology companies, financial institutions, and consulting firms actively recruit doctoral graduates for senior positions. Job titles include Research Scientist, Principal Security Engineer, Director of Cybersecurity, and Chief Information Security Officer. In these roles, you apply your research skills to solve complex problems, develop new products, and guide organizational strategy. Government agencies like the NSA, FBI, and Department of Defense also hire PhDs for high-level analytical and leadership positions.

Entrepreneurship is another path. Some graduates found their own cybersecurity companies, developing innovative products or services based on their dissertation research. Others work as independent consultants, advising organizations on security strategy and incident response. The analytical and problem-solving skills honed during a doctorate are valuable in any context where rigorous thinking is required.

Frequently Asked Questions

How long does it take to complete a PhD in cyber security?
Most programs take four to seven years. The timeline depends on whether you study full-time or part-time, the structure of the program, and the time required to complete your dissertation.

Can I earn a PhD in cyber security entirely online?
Yes. Many accredited universities now offer fully online doctoral programs in cybersecurity. Some may require short on-campus residencies, but the majority of coursework and research can be completed remotely.

What are the admission requirements for a cybersecurity doctorate?
Requirements vary but typically include a master’s degree in a related field, strong academic transcripts, letters of recommendation, a statement of purpose, and GRE scores (though many programs have waived this requirement). Relevant professional experience is often valued.

Do I need a background in computer science to apply?
While a technical background is helpful, some programs accept students with degrees in information systems, engineering, mathematics, or even social sciences if they demonstrate relevant coursework or experience. Interdisciplinary perspectives are increasingly valued in cybersecurity research.

What is the difference between a PhD and a Doctor of Cybersecurity (D.Cyber)?
A PhD is a research-focused degree that prepares you for academic or high-level research roles. A D.Cyber or professional doctorate is more practice-oriented, emphasizing the application of existing knowledge to organizational problems. Choose based on your career goals.

How much does a PhD in cyber security cost?
Costs vary widely, from fully funded programs that cover tuition and provide a stipend to programs costing $30,000 to $80,000 total. Always research funding options and total cost of attendance before applying.
